
As A Blue Hen: Redshirt junior who is entering his fourth year at Delaware • two-year letterwinner • will again challenge for a starting position at the small forward spot for the Blue Hens • athletic forward who is an excellent rebounder • serving as a team captain this season along with Jamelle Hagins and Devon Saddler.

2008-09 Season: Suffered a torn labrum in preseason and missed the entire year • redshirted the season and maintained freshman eligibility.
High School: Two-year starter at Menchville High School in Newport News, Va. • recorded a season-high 14 points and 12 rebounds versus Bethel in 2007 • played senior year of high school at Massanutten Military Academy in Woodstock, Va. • averaged 10 points, six rebounds and four assists per game as a senior.
Personal: Kelvin McNeil, Jr. • son of Kelvin and Ella McNeil • has a younger brother, Tevin • sport management major at Delaware • enjoys watching cartoons, movies and reality television shows in his free time.
